CEOs, scholars: B&R to boost Southeast Asia's development

Ming Choon Goh, chairman of BGMC Corporation Sdn Bhd, made a speech at the opening ceremony of the Tsinghua PBCSF Belt and Road EMBA Program for Southeast Asia on May 11, 2017 in Beijing.[Photo provided to chinadaily.com.cn]

The Belt and Road Initiative will benefit both China and Southeast Asia, creating infinite opportunities for businesses and also bringing different civilizations closer through dialogues, said Goh.

Goh said Malaysia decided to support the initiative as it had the potential to help the country, adding that Chinese capital has flown to ports and railways in Malaysia.
